of course ? First you must have the program: GRF Editor

Open your GRF and add the folder I passed you into it, merge it.

step1.thumb.png.3c4ea25c1ec3d3b63722ed6451811321.png

After performing the merge, you must save your grf, and you're done!

image.png.d79b82a9f332ca73ca7a3c53d0912489.png

Attention: You will only be able to merge like this, because I have separated the folders in the directories correctly.
Not all members separate files correctly for support.
